Each line above is labelled. A fact is quoted from the named source, with its date. A calculation is worked out by Districts from those facts — you can check the arithmetic. An interpretation is Districts' opinion of what the evidence means, not a fact, a valuation, or advice. Anything we haven't retrieved yet is marked as missing rather than treated as a pass.

Key Features:
• Water views across Swansea Channel with uninterrupted outlook
• Four bedrooms plus flexible rumpus | Three and a half bathrooms
• Double garage with additional off-street parking and existing shed
• Expansive 1,108sqm (approx.) level block with rare dual street access and rear lane
• Ideal for boat, caravan, jet ski or trailer storage
• Light-filled open-plan upper living capturing coastal breezes and natural light
• Polished timber floors enhancing warmth and coastal character
• Caesarstone kitchen with stainless steel appliances, generous bench space and storage
• Master suite with spa ensuite, built-in robes and direct verandah access
• Front verandah overlooking the Channel, ideal for sunrise coffees and sunset drinks
• Flexible lower-level accommodation with separate entry ideal for guests, teenagers or extended family
• Lower-level rumpus, additional bathroom and multi-purpose living space
• Outdoor shower and separate toilet, perfect after beach, boating or fishing
• Rear yard access via double gates
• Scope to extend, add a pool or further enhance (STCA)
• Walking distance to Swansea RSL, cafés, local shops and public boat ramps
• Minutes to surf beaches, lake foreshore and coastal walking tracks
• Ideal lifestyle property for boating, fishing, swimming and water-based living
• Sought-after coastal address within Lake Macquarie, one of NSW's most desirable lifestyle regions
• Approximately 90 minutes from Sydney, ideal for permanent living or weekend escape
• Exceptional lifestyle opportunity combining land, outlook and long-term potential
Comparable Sales - Channel Street, Swansea
• 53 Channel Street, Swansea
- Land size approximately 412 sqm
- Sold for $1,850,000 in 2025
• 5 Channel Street, Swansea (knock-down)
- Land size approximately 1,069 sqm
- Sold for $2,560,000 in 2023
